Toyoki Onimaru opened Onimaru Toyoki Kiln in the traditional Koishiwara ceramics hub of T?h? Village, Fukuoka Prefecture in 1982 after training under ceramic artist Tetsuzo Ota. A local of the area, Onimaru has handcrafted traditional Koishiwara ware with his family for over 40 years. His works are a combination of practicality and beauty, incorporating traditional artisanship with modern design to create vessels able to blend seamlessly into contemporary lifestyles.
